Decoding the 2003 Acura TL Wiring Diagram
A 2003 Acura TL wiring diagram is essentially a map of your car's electrical pathways. It illustrates how all the various electrical components – from the headlights and radio to the engine control unit and safety systems – are connected by wires. Think of it as the blueprint for the car's nervous system. Without it, diagnosing electrical issues would be like trying to find a specific needle in a haystack blindfolded. Understanding this diagram is crucial for anyone looking to perform maintenance, repairs, or even simple upgrades.
These diagrams are not just simple lines; they contain a wealth of information. Key elements you'll find include:
- Wire colors: Each wire is depicted with its specific color code, which is vital for tracing connections.
- Component symbols: Standardized symbols represent different parts like switches, relays, fuses, sensors, and modules.
- Connection points: The diagram shows where wires connect to each other and to various components.
- Circuit protection: Information on fuses and circuit breakers is included to safeguard against electrical overloads.
Using a 2003 Acura TL wiring diagram allows for systematic troubleshooting. Instead of randomly checking components, you can follow a specific circuit. For example, if your brake lights aren't working, you can use the diagram to trace the power from the brake pedal switch, through the necessary wiring, to the brake light bulbs. This methodical approach saves time and prevents unnecessary part replacements. The diagram also helps in understanding the function of different systems:
- Ignition system: How the key turns on power to various components.
- Lighting system: How headlights, taillights, and interior lights operate.
- Audio system: The wiring for your stereo and speakers.
- Engine control system: The complex network of sensors and actuators that manage engine performance.
